Police confirm abduction of ABSU DVC

From Okey Sampson, Umuahia

Abia State Police command has confirmed the abduction of Abia State University, Uturu (ABSU) Deputy Vice Chancellor, Professor Godwin Emezue.

A statement from the Police Public Relations Officer (PPRO) of the command, Maureen Chinaka, confirming the incident, said on January 26, at about 9.30pm, the Command received information that on the same date, at about 7pm, the DVC was abducted.

Chinaka said the hoodlums abducted Prof Emezue at a petrol station in Umuekwu Amachara, Umuahia South LGA, Abia State, where he went in company of the wife to buy fuel

The PPRO stated that during the incident, the hoodlums confiscated his wife’s ATM card, dragged the DVC into a Lexus SUV, and drove away with the victim.

The statement said the Abia State Police Command has deployed resources and assets including intelligence and technical aid towards unravelling the crime, with a view to safely rescuing the victim from his captors.

While urging Abians to remain calm and continue their legitimate activities, the command sought the cooperation of the public in the area of providing useful information to fight crime in the state.
